Subject: [PATCH 0/2] Add sq24905c support
Date: Mon, 4 Aug 2025 20:48:03 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250804124806.540-1-tomtsai764@gmail.com> (raw)
The SQ24905C is also a Hot-swap controller similar to the ADM1278, with the
following differences:
* The MFR_ID register data is different.
* The MFR_MODEL register data is different.
It also introduces two parameters "silergy,power-sample-average" and
"silergy,volt-curr-sample-average" for Digital Power Monitor. Device tree
bindings are updated accordingly.
The currently available ADM1275 driver supports the ADM1278 and this patch
adds support for the SQ24905C. The datasheet see link for reference.
